      Hey Long Nguyen,
      We have some troubleshooting steps here that you can follow and may help.
      The first thing I would recommend doing would be resetting the System Management Controller. Resetting the System Management Controller (or SMC) in a Mac can be a useful way to troubleshoot various kinds of problems that arise, typically related to power issues or issues that coincide with new hardware being installed in the computer. Detailed instructions on performing a SMC reset can be found on Apple's website here: support.apple.com/en-us/HT201295
      After resetting the SMC, I would also want to perform a NVRAM or PRAM reset. This can be done with the following instructions:
      PRAM Reset:
      1) Start the machine while holding down the Option-Apple-P-R keys
      2) Wait until you hear the 3rd startup chime, then let go of the keys and let the machine boot up.
      Lastly, we would want to go through a proper conditioning cycle, to help the battery reach its maximum lifespan. This process will help calibrate the battery and extend the full charge life. You can find this process with detailed instructions on our Battery Conditioning Guide: eshop.macsales.com/Tech/manuals/newertech/batteries/batteryconditioning_r1w.pdf
      If these steps fail to work in getting your battery performing up to specs, please let me know and we can look into this issue further for you.
